Claim Rejections - 35 USC § 101
35 U.S.C. 101 reads as follows:
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title.
Claims 1,3-4,21,23-25 and 27-34 are rejected under 35 U.S.C. 101 because the claimed invention is directed to an abstract idea without significantly more.
Claim 1 recites:
A pulse oximeter system, the system comprising:
a physiological sensor that is applied to a tissue site of a patient and connected to a patient device associated with the patient, wherein the physiological sensor is configured to measure a plurality of oxygen saturation parameter values;
a data storage system that stores a plurality of historical events, wherein each historical event from the plurality of historical events comprises a respective oxygen saturation parameter value for the patient at a corresponding timestamp; and
a multi-patient monitoring and analytics system that communicates with the patient device and with a clinician device over a network, wherein the multi-patient monitoring and analytics system is configured to:
receive, from a plurality of patient devices, the plurality of oxygen saturation parameter values and the corresponding timestamps;
store the plurality of oxygen saturation parameter values and the corresponding timestamps in the data storage system;
receive input comprising a first domain indicating a group of patient devices;
receive a time range comprising a start time and an end time;
receive an oxygen drop percentage, a time window, and a duration;
execute a first query comprising input parameters, the input parameters comprising the domain, the start time, and the end time, wherein executing the first query comprises: identifying, from the plurality of historical events, a subset of the historical events from the domain and within the start time and the end time;
identify, from the first subset of the historical events, a second subset of the historical events, wherein to identify: the second subset of the historical events, the multi-patient monitoring and analytics system is configured to:
compute, for a particular patient, a patient-specific baseline oxygen saturation over the time window;
apply a sliding window to search the historical events; and
identify, for a particular patient, one or more desaturation events defined by oxygen saturation parameter values that are at least the oxygen drop percentage, below the patient-specific baseline for a continuous period that is at least the duration;
generate oxygen desaturation summary data comprising a quantity of oxygen desaturation events for each patient from the second subset of the historical events, wherein the oxygen desaturation summary data is associated with a plurality of patients;
output the oxygen desaturation summary data for presentation, wherein the presentation comprises desaturation data of the plurality of patients.
Step 1:
The claim as a whole falls within at least one statutory category, i.e. a process, machine, manufacture, or composition of matter.
Step 2A Prong One:
The highlighted portion, as drafted, is a process that, under its broadest reasonable interpretation, falls under “Certain methods of organizing human activity” because the steps of processing data for a patient have been traditionally performed by a human being, i.e. managing personal behavior or relationships or interactions between people (including social activities, teaching, and following rules or instructions). MPEP 2106.04(a)(2)(II)
But for the recitation of high-level computing components like a generic computer used, each of these steps, when considered as a whole, describe a selection process that could take place between various human entities of a patient’s care team, e.g. the patient and one or more medical professionals. For example, a patient could provide medical information about themselves (i.e. various forms of patient data as recited) to a medical professional during an appointment or other interaction, and the medical professional could analyze/process the received information to determine an appropriate alarm level. Thus, the steps recited in this claim describe the various interactions between a patient and one or more medical professionals, and accordingly claim 1 recites an abstract idea in the form of a certain method of organizing human activity.
At best, these claims recite the use of a generic computer to perform the abstract concept.
In the above steps, a clinician could perform this type of determination when viewing data for a patient. Therefore, the steps are directed towards certain methods of organizing human activities.
The highlighted portion, as drafted, is a process that, under its broadest reasonable interpretation, falls under “Mental processes”.
But for a generic computer recited with a high level of generality, the steps may be performed in the human mind either mentally or with pen and paper.
Accordingly, these limitations have been found to be directed towards concepts performed in the human mind (including an observation, evaluation, judgment, opinion). MPEP 2106.04(a)(2)(III)
The different categories of abstract ideas are being considered together as one single abstract idea. MPEP 2106.04(II)(B)

Step 2A Prong Two:
This judicial exception is not integrated into a practical application. In particular, the claim recites the following additional element(s), if any:
a physiological sensor that is applied to a tissue site of a patient and connected to a patient device associated with the patient, wherein the physiological sensor is configured to measure a plurality of oxygen saturation parameter values;
a data storage system that stores a plurality of historical events, wherein each historical event from the plurality of historical events comprises a respective oxygen saturation parameter value for the patient at a corresponding timestamp; and
a multi-patient monitoring and analytics system that communicates with the patient device and with a clinician device over a network, wherein the multi-patient monitoring and analytics system is configured to:
receive, from a plurality of patient devices, the plurality of oxygen saturation parameter values and the corresponding timestamps;
store the plurality of oxygen saturation parameter values and the corresponding timestamps in the data storage system;
receive input comprising a first domain indicating a group of patient devices;
receive a time range comprising a start time and an end time;
receive an oxygen drop percentage, a time window, and a duration;
output the oxygen desaturation summary data for presentation, wherein the presentation comprises desaturation data of the plurality of patients.
The additional element(s) do(es) not integrate the abstract idea into a practical application, other than the abstract idea per se.
Regarding the patient device, the Specification as originally filed on 08 October 2018 in parent application 62742781 (hereafter referred to as “the Provisional Specification”) discloses a variety of types of devices (page 10 paragraph 0043 disclosing “and the like”).
Regarding the data storage system invoked to store a plurality of data, the Provisional Specification discloses a generic computer storage system with a high level of generality (page 10 paragraph 0043 disclosing a data storage system without any additional details).
Regarding the a multi-patient monitoring and analytics system recited to receive and process data, this limitation, the Provisional Specification discloses a generic computer to perform the various steps (page 60 paragraph 0161 disclosing “any number of devices”).
Regarding the clinician device, the Provisional Specification discloses any generic computer (page 10-11 paragraph 0044 disclosing “any other device”).
Accordingly, these limitations amount(s) to mere instructions to apply an exception (invoking computers as a tool to perform the abstract idea). MPEP 2106.05(f))
Regarding the physiological sensor measuring data with timestamps, the Provisional Specification discloses a variety of sensors (page 10 paragraph 0043 disclosing “and the like”).
Regarding the network, the Provisional Specification discloses any type of known network (page 9-10 paragraph 0042).
Regarding the user interfaces used to display and receive data, the Provisional Specification discloses many types of user interfaces, including generic user interfaces capable of providing the recited functionality (page 16 paragraph 0053).
Regarding the user input to launch an interface by selecting a displayed component, i.e. patient indicator, this limitation is merely directed towards insignificant extra-solution activity, i.e. data selection for display.
Similarly, the step of displaying data in a full-screen display of a device is also merely directed towards insignificant extra-solution activity, i.e. data selection for display.
Accordingly, these limitations merely add(s) insignificant extra-solution activity to the abstract idea (mere data gathering, selecting a particular data source or type of data to be manipulated, insignificant application). MPEP 2106.05(g))
Dependent claim(s) recite(s) additional subject matter which amount to limitation(s) consistent with the additional element(s) in the independent claims (such as claim(s) 3-4, 32 reciting a generic computer and display in a manner consistent with the independent claim 1 above and incorporated herein).
Looking at the limitations as an ordered combination adds nothing that is not already present when looking at the elements taken individually. There is no indication that the combination of elements improves the functioning of a computer or improves any other technology. Their collective functions merely provide conventional computer implementation and do not impose a meaningful limit to integrate the abstract idea into a practical application.
Accordingly, the additional elements do not integrate the judicial exception into a practical application because it does not impose any meaningful limits on practicing the abstract idea.
Accordingly, the claim recites an abstract idea.
Step 2B:
The claim does not include additional elements that are sufficient to amount to significantly more than the judicial exception. As discussed above with respect to integration of the abstract idea into a practical application, the additional elements amount to no more than mere instructions to apply an exception, add insignificant extra-solution activity to the abstract idea, and/or generally link the abstract idea to a particular technological environment or field of use.
The additional elements, as discussed above and incorporated herein, amount to no more than mere instructions to apply an exception, add insignificant extra-solution activity to the abstract idea, and/or generally link the abstract idea to a particular technological environment or field of use, as discussed above and incorporated herein.
Mere instructions to apply an exception, insignificant extra-solution activity, and linking to a particular technological environment using a generic computer component cannot provide an inventive concept.
Examiner notes that the physiological sensors have been described by Applicant in a manner that would be well-understood, routine, and conventional (WURC) in the pertinent arts as performing their existing and known functions (Provisional Specification, page 10 paragraph 0043).
Regarding the network, this limitation has been identified by the courts as being WURC in the pertinent arts, e.g., receiving or transmitting data over a network. Symantec, MPEP 2106.05(d)(II)(i)
Regarding the user interface, the Provisional Specification discloses that generic computer graphical user interfaces may be used to implement the recite functionality (page 16 paragraph 0053), and amounts to a finding of well-understood, routine, and conventional in the pertinent arts.
Regarding the step of displaying data in a full-screen display of a device, Sampath (20160283665) discloses a window that can be maximized to occupy the entire display of a physician’s device (Figure 28 upper right corner illustrating a Maximize Window icon) in a manner that would be WURC in the pertinent arts.
Dependent claims recite additional subject matter which amount to limitations consistent with the additional elements in the independent claims.
Looking at the limitations as an ordered combination adds nothing that is not already present when looking at the elements taken individually. There is no indication that the combination of elements improves the functioning of a computer or improves any other technology. Their collective functions merely provide conventional computer implementation.
The claim is not patent eligible.

Subject Matter Free of Prior Art
Claim(s) 1,3-4,21,23-25 and 27-34 distinguish(es) over the prior art for the following reasons.
The following is a statement of reasons for the subject matter free of prior art:
Claim 1: the primary reason for the indication of subject matter free of prior art is the inclusion of the following limitations in the combination as recited in the abstract concept and not found in the closest available prior art of record:
execute a first query comprising input parameters, the input parameters comprising the domain, the start time, and the end time, wherein executing the first query comprises: identifying, from the plurality of historical events, a subset of the historical events from the domain and within the start time and the end time;
identify, from the first subset of the historical events, a second subset of the historical events, wherein to identify: the second subset of the historical events, the multi-patient monitoring and analytics system is configured to:
compute, for a particular patient, a patient-specific baseline oxygen saturation over the time window;
apply a sliding window to search the historical events; and
identify, for a particular patient, one or more desaturation events defined by oxygen saturation parameter values that are at least the oxygen drop percentage, below the patient-specific baseline for a continuous period that is at least the duration;
generate oxygen desaturation summary data comprising a quantity of oxygen desaturation events for each patient from the second subset of the historical events, wherein the oxygen desaturation summary data is associated with a plurality of patients;
The closest available prior art of record are as follows:
Sampath discloses a pulse oximetry capable of generating an alarm when SpO.sub.2 drops below safe levels (page 14 paragraph 0185), but does not fairly disclose or suggest generating an summary based on the sliding window, as claimed.
Based on the evidence presented above, none of the closest available prior art of record fairly discloses or suggests the claimed invention. For this reason, claim 1 would be found to be subject matter free of prior art.

Response to Arguments
In the Remarks filed on 02 February 2026, Applicant makes numerous arguments. Examiner will address these arguments in the order presented.
On page 13-17 Applicant argues that the previously applied art do not fairly disclose or suggest the claimed invention.
Applicant’s arguments, have been carefully considered and are persuasive. The rejection of all pending claims under Section 102 and 103(a) has been withdrawn.
On page 18 Applicant argues that the steps of computing a baseline and sliding-window for patients and devices cannot be practically performed in the human mind.
While Applicant’s arguments have been fully considered, they are not found persuasive because the claims do not recite any limitation that would not be practically performed in the human mind either mentally or with pen and paper. In making this argument, Applicant provides no evidence or assertion regarding why these steps would not be practically performed in the human mind.
Additionally, these steps are also directed towards Certain Methods of Organizing Human Activity. See the section above, and incorporated herein.
On page 18-19 Applicant argues that the claims provide technical improvement.
While Applicant’s arguments have been carefully considered, they are not persuasive because the argued limitations are part of the abstract idea.
Even newly discovered or novel judicial exceptions are still exceptions. MPEP 2106.04(I)
Based on the evidence presented above, Applicant’s arguments are not found persuasive.
